JavaScript new Map()
- صفحه قبلی new Map()
- صفحه بعدی clear()
- بازگشت به طبقه بالاتر دستورالعملهای مرجع Map JavaScript
پیشنهاد دوره:
new Map()
تعریف و استفاده
تابع ساختگر برای ایجاد شیء Map استفاده میشود.
توجه داشته باشید new Map()
شیء Map فقط میتواند از
برای ساخت.
مثال
مثال 1 new Map()
با انتقال یک آرایه به
// ایجاد یک Map const fruits = new Map([ ["apples", 500], ["bananas", 300], ["oranges", 200] ]);
مثال 2
یک شیء جدید Map ایجاد کنید و از آن استفاده کنید set()
روش افزودن عناصر:
// ایجاد یک Map const fruits = new Map(); // تنظیم مقادیر Map fruits.set("apples", 500); fruits.set("bananas", 300); fruits.set("oranges", 200);
نحوه نوشتن
new Map(iterable)پارامتر
پارامتر | توضیح |
---|---|
iterable | اختیاری. یک شیء قابل جستجوی شامل جفتهای کلید-مقدار است. |
مقدار بازگشتی
نوع | توضیح |
---|---|
Object | مجموعه جدید Map. |
پشتیبانی مرورگرها
Map یکی از ویژگیهای ECMAScript6 (ES6) است.
از ژوئن 2017، تمام مرورگرهای مدرن از ES6 (JavaScript 2015) پشتیبانی میکنند:
کروم | ایج | فایرفاکس | سفاری | اپرا |
---|---|---|---|---|
کروم 51 | ایج 15 | فایرفاکس 54 | سفاری 10 | اپرا 38 |
2016 سال 5 ماه | 2017 سال 4 ماه | ژوئن 2017 | سپتامبر 2016 | ژوئن 2016 |
Map در Internet Explorer پشتیبانی نمیشود.
- صفحه قبلی new Map()
- صفحه بعدی clear()
- بازگشت به طبقه بالاتر دستورالعملهای مرجع Map JavaScript